Colleges Begin Visits to Campus

Greenies to host admission representatives throughout school year

Christ School's College Guidance Office is there every step of the way when a Greenie is plotting out his future, but no one knows the ins and outs of a particular college better than one of its admissions representatives. And starting this week, the Christ School student body will have a chance to speak with those reps face-to-face on campus.

The first four colleges lined up for visits to Christ School are:

  • University of Richmond (Tuesday at 1:55 p.m.)
  • Birmingham-Southern College (Wednesday at 1:05 p.m)
  • Furman University (Thursday at 9:30 a.m.)
  • Hampden-Sydney College (Thursday at 1:35 p.m.)

If interested, boys should sign up at least 24 hours in advance, either online through the Naviance Family Connection program or on sheets posted outside the College Guidance Office. Kirk Blackard, who is head of the College Guidance Office, said there will be a special presentation by West Point and the ROTC program next week in Pingree Auditorium.

The College Guidance Office will continue to update students on more visits as they are confirmed. College Guidance is a three-man department consisting of Blackard, Jeff Depelteau, and Thomas Becker.
